Error description
On issueing a -STOP DB2 MODE(FORCE), an ABEND0C4 PIC11 in DSNAET03 at offset X'27A' because of a freemained FDBK area by DSNAPRHX.

ABEND0Dx), a * * -STOP DB2,MODE(FORCE), etc. * * This APAR is the DB2 V2.3 retro-fit * * of APAR PN49994. * **************************************************************** * RECOMMENDATION: * **************************************************************** A customer entered -STOP DB2,MODE(FORCE) on a DB2 system that had many active users. One user that was connected to DB2 received the expected RC00F30011 (DB2 not up) reason code when it attempted an SQL call. At this point, the program request handler (DSNAPRHX) recognized that the connection with DB2 had been lost, so it freed the storage that was gotten for this user when the connection was first established. DB2 Translate (DSNAET03) was invoked to translate the reason code into a SQLCODE and to fill in the SQLCA. DSNAET03 did the translate and, since it was an SQLCODE-923, DSNAET03 attempted to get additional error information from the user feedback (FRBFBACK) area. However, FRBFBACK contained a residual pointer to the FDBK area, which had been freed by DSNAPRHX when the connection was lost. Since FRBFBACK was non-zero, DSNAET03 attempted to use the residual pointer and received an ABEND0C4. Note that the ABEND0C4 failure is possible in situations other than just the -STOP DB2,MODE(FORCE). This scenario can occur whenever a connection lost is detected by DSNAPRHX. The most common occurrences of this would be: the loss of the cross memory bind (eg ABEND0Dx) between the allied user and DB2, an ABEND0C4 trying to verify the program request handler work area (PRHW) storage, or a -STOP DB2,MODE(FORCE). This APAR is the DB2 V2.3 retro-fit of APAR PN49994.
Problem conclusion
DSNAPRHX has been changed to clear the FRBFBACK pointer if it points to the FDBK area that is about to be freed.
